What type of 600 camera did you I-type modify? Some of the older box cams required you to half hold the shutter plunger to charge up the flash, and some of the newer one always fired it. To me it looks like the flash isn't going off, especially if you got a faint image on one attempt.

I'd add in a small switch to cut off the battery from the camera when it is not in use. The i-1's "off" still uses power, and will drain the cells rather quickly without some easy way to disconnect it. Did that when I swapped the battery in mine, and it is definitely nice to have. Just don't turn the battery cutoff switch off with a partially shot pack in the camera, or it will eject a shot thinking it is a new pack's dark slide.
